THE Taoiseach’s proposal to hold a referendum on the rights of children and young people under 18 is truly groundbreaking.

The announcement follows many years of intensive campaigning for greater protection and equality for young people by the National Youth Council of Ireland (NYCI).

As the national representative body for voluntary youth work organisations in Ireland, NYCI will work with the Government and opposition to frame provisions ensuring that the human rights of children and young people are properly enshrined in our constitution.
